Despite an initially rocky start, Final Fantasy VII Rebirth has firmly established itself as a standout title in the gaming industry. The game's excellence has been recognized with eight nominations at the prestigious Famitsu Dengeki Game Awards, showcasing its achievements across various categories. These nominations include:

  • Game of the Year
  • Best Studio
  • Best Story
  • Best Graphics
  • Best Music
  • Best Performance: Maaya Sakamoto as Iris
  • Best Character: Tifa
  • Best Role-Playing Game

Since its release, Final Fantasy VII Rebirth from Square Enix has captivated both players and reviewers with its expansive narrative depth and emotional storytelling. While the game encountered some challenges at launch, it quickly garnered praise for its technical and artistic merits. The subsequent release of the PC version boosted sales, and the game has achieved impressive scores, earning a 92% rating from critics and an 89% score from users on Metacritic since its 2024 debut.

Key highlights of the game include its breathtaking visuals, enchanting soundtrack, and unforgettable characters. Tifa and Iris have emerged as fan favorites, with Maaya Sakamoto's performance as Iris receiving special recognition as one of the year's best voice acting achievements.
